Obama was in town; traffic was a bitch

I was coming home from pizza night last night and roads were blocked in Coconut Grove. Douglas was blocked at Ingram Road and traffic had to go through the Edgewater Drive neighborhood to come back out at LeJeune Road and take that to US1 and so on. I think Obama was at a dinner on St. Gaudens Road, wonder if it was at the house that was slated to be destroyed and now it housed the President of the United States. If it was, people can now say of the historic house, "Obama ate here."

The Grove has been popular with Obama over the years and Joe Biden usually stays at a house near Vizcaya, back near where Madonna used to live. So we're quite popular with the leaders of the free world.
